Class AlertmanagerWebSpecFluent<A extends AlertmanagerWebSpecFluent<A>>
- java.lang.Object
-
- io.fabric8.kubernetes.api.builder.BaseFluent<A>
-
- io.fabric8.openshift.api.model.monitoring.v1.AlertmanagerWebSpecFluent<A>
-
- Direct Known Subclasses:
AlertmanagerSpecFluent.WebNested,AlertmanagerWebSpecBuilder
public class AlertmanagerWebSpecFluent<A extends AlertmanagerWebSpecFluent<A>> extends io.fabric8.kubernetes.api.builder.BaseFluent<A>Generated
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description classAlertmanagerWebSpecFluent.HttpConfigNested<N>classAlertmanagerWebSpecFluent.TlsConfigNested<N>
-
Constructor Summary
Constructors Constructor Description AlertmanagerWebSpecFluent()AlertmanagerWebSpecFluent(AlertmanagerWebSpec instance)
-
Method Summary
-
-
-
Constructor Detail
-
AlertmanagerWebSpecFluent
public AlertmanagerWebSpecFluent()
-
AlertmanagerWebSpecFluent
public AlertmanagerWebSpecFluent(AlertmanagerWebSpec instance)
-
-
Method Detail
-
copyInstance
protected void copyInstance(AlertmanagerWebSpec instance)
-
getGetConcurrency
public Long getGetConcurrency()
-
hasGetConcurrency
public boolean hasGetConcurrency()
-
buildHttpConfig
public WebHTTPConfig buildHttpConfig()
-
withHttpConfig
public A withHttpConfig(WebHTTPConfig httpConfig)
-
hasHttpConfig
public boolean hasHttpConfig()
-
withNewHttpConfig
public AlertmanagerWebSpecFluent.HttpConfigNested<A> withNewHttpConfig()
-
withNewHttpConfigLike
public AlertmanagerWebSpecFluent.HttpConfigNested<A> withNewHttpConfigLike(WebHTTPConfig item)
-
editHttpConfig
public AlertmanagerWebSpecFluent.HttpConfigNested<A> editHttpConfig()
-
editOrNewHttpConfig
public AlertmanagerWebSpecFluent.HttpConfigNested<A> editOrNewHttpConfig()
-
editOrNewHttpConfigLike
public AlertmanagerWebSpecFluent.HttpConfigNested<A> editOrNewHttpConfigLike(WebHTTPConfig item)
-
getTimeout
public Long getTimeout()
-
hasTimeout
public boolean hasTimeout()
-
buildTlsConfig
public WebTLSConfig buildTlsConfig()
-
withTlsConfig
public A withTlsConfig(WebTLSConfig tlsConfig)
-
hasTlsConfig
public boolean hasTlsConfig()
-
withNewTlsConfig
public AlertmanagerWebSpecFluent.TlsConfigNested<A> withNewTlsConfig()
-
withNewTlsConfigLike
public AlertmanagerWebSpecFluent.TlsConfigNested<A> withNewTlsConfigLike(WebTLSConfig item)
-
editTlsConfig
public AlertmanagerWebSpecFluent.TlsConfigNested<A> editTlsConfig()
-
editOrNewTlsConfig
public AlertmanagerWebSpecFluent.TlsConfigNested<A> editOrNewTlsConfig()
-
editOrNewTlsConfigLike
public AlertmanagerWebSpecFluent.TlsConfigNested<A> editOrNewTlsConfigLike(WebTLSConfig item)
-
withAdditionalProperties
public <K,V> A withAdditionalProperties(Map<String,Object> additionalProperties)
-
hasAdditionalProperties
public boolean hasAdditionalProperties()
-
equals
public boolean equals(Object o)
- Overrides:
equalsin classio.fabric8.kubernetes.api.builder.BaseFluent<A extends AlertmanagerWebSpecFluent<A>>
-
hashCode
public int hashCode()
- Overrides:
hashCodein classio.fabric8.kubernetes.api.builder.BaseFluent<A extends AlertmanagerWebSpecFluent<A>>
-
-